The right material to choose

The material you choose for doors and windows will have a major effect on their performance, longevity and value. Wood is a preferred choice because it brings warmth to a house and is durable. It's essential to select timber that is certified by the Forest Stewardship Council (FSC) to ensure that it's harvested and processed in a sustainable manner. FSC certification can also be used to earn points for builders who participate in the LEED or NAHB's home certification program.

UPVC is another popular option due to its energy efficiency and long-lasting durability. It has a natural insulation quality and creates a tight seal to stop air leaks. It's also easy to maintain as it doesn't require staining or sanding. It's also able to be cleaned with a mixture of water and soap.

UPVC is offered in a variety of styles, colours and imitation effects to fit every home. For example, choosing the darkest shade such as Anthracite Grey can create a modern look to a house and a wood-effect uPVC is a perfect match for an older building. UPVC is highly weatherproof and will not fade or degrade over time. This is especially advantageous for areas in close proximity to wild or natural areas. UPVC is also resistant to corrosion and does not react with moisture.

Selecting the right hardware

It is essential to choose the appropriate hardware for the fenestration to ensure it's sturdy and reliable. It can also protect the building from climate conditions and help reduce maintenance costs. However, it is often not considered when selecting the final door or window. The selection of the proper hinges and friction stays is vital because they are the window's invisible functional hardware, similar to a heart in the body. They are the main operational life of the window repair leeds. in the event of a mistake, it can lead to operating failure or sliding.

The homeowner should select the color of window hardware to match their preference for style. For instance, some homeowners prefer white window hardware to be a match to other finishes within the home. Some prefer to have the hardware match the color of the windows to give an uniform appearance.
